Do you need a fishing license on private property in Kansas?

Landowners, tenets and members of their immediate family living with them are exempt from fishing license requirements for waters on land they own or lease for agricultural purposes

How much is a 3 pole permit in Kansas?

Kansas fishing regulations restrict anglers to two rods with no more than two baited hooks (single or treble) or artificial lures per line However, all anglers, regardless of age, may use a third rod with the purchase of an annual $650 three-pole permit

What is the limit on catfish in Kansas?

Statewide Creel & Length Limits Type of Fish Number of Fish Channel catfish 10 Blue catfish 5 Walleye, sauger, saugeye (single species or in combination) 5 Rainbow trout, brown trout (single species or in combination) 5
